Don't reply if the recovery room scammers at OptionsRefund.com write back to you. Now that they have your email, you may also get other messages from other recovery scams. Some will claim to be hackers who can take the money from the company for uou. Some may even pretend to be from regulators.

Anyone can create a UK company. Visiting the UK isn't even necessary. Registered in the UK does not mean regulated in the UK. Many scam companies around the world have used UK registrations to pretend they are operating from the UK.

No one can guarantee a settlement within 60 days. Any company promising that is lying to you. That is the sort of false promise frequently used by recovery room scams.
